Abstract

A conducting rod drilling clamp relates to the field of machining equipment and comprises a workbench; a support is fixed on the workbench; a positioning clamping block is fixed at the upper end of the support; one end of the positioning clamping block extends out of the support, and a positioning hole is formed at the end of the positioning clamping block; a gap is formed along the axis line of the positioning hole; the part of the positioning clamping block which extends out of the support is divided into two parts; and a rotating handle with threads formed at one end passes through the outermost end of the part of the positioning clamping block which extends out of the support. The conducting rod drilling clamp has the advantages of simple structure, reasonable design, capability of realizing fast clamping, simplicity and convenience in operation, and high working efficiency, and can ensure position tolerance of a threaded hole.

Background technology:
Need a large amount of copper cylinder conducting rods in the vacuum switch, conducting rod need at one end process the screwed hole along axis.
Original processing mode is on workpiece, after the line, to clamp with bench vice, boring, tapping on drilling machine.This processing mode inefficiency, positional precision are difficult to guarantee.
